Is there a clean way to eliminate the power switches in the console?
Yes. I bought a used switch bezel from eBay that has provision for driver power switch and a cubby hole replacing the passenger power switch. These were for cars ordered with a manual passenger seat. I saw one on eBay that should fit your car. Think it was listed for $35

Converting to manual was one of the best things I did to my 94'. A member on here donated a "cubby" from a low option car for me to get rid of the power seat switches in my console. The power seats in my car still functioned pretty well, but the drivers side had a noticeable back and forth "rock" to it that just made the interior feel even cheaper to me. Now its all nice and solid. Only I drive the car, so set it and forget it. If I would have ordered this car new I would have gone as low option as possible. Less to break, and it ages better.
